Prof. Dieter Crumbiegel studied painting with Prof. Fritz Winter and Marie-Louise von Rogister and ceramics with Walter Popp (HfBK Kassel). He is artistically active mainly in the field of modern ceramics.
In 1974 Crumbiegel was awarded the State Prize of the State of Rheinland-Pfalz and in 1975 the 1st prize in the competition "German Contemporary Ceramics".
In addition, the artist lectures as professor at the Hochschule Niederrhein in Krefeld, returning to painting in 1984.
